Quote from Jerry in The Marine Biologist
Elaine: Oh, don't you know what this means? It's like working with Tolstoy. Jerry: Hey, you know what, I read the most unbelievable thing about Tolstoy the other day. Did you know the original title for "War and Peace" was "War - What Is It Good For?"! Elaine: Ha ha. Jerry: No, no. I'm not kidding, Elaine. It's true. His mistress didn't like the title and insisted that he change it to "War and Peace"! Elaine: But it's a line from that song. Jerry: That's where they got it from.
